Output dcd7526ca630660ba0a218722fb422009a2e16b085f23b6e3b78875b49b2078d:0

value
3151872
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d269fe93a7901ddebfeec9bb856f6a42b0fcd1b OP_EQUALVERIFY OP_CHECKSIG
address
1DsLYjgtXkEcQWStLtLGa163teq2SxXjXR
transaction
dcd7526ca630660ba0a218722fb422009a2e16b085f23b6e3b78875b49b2078d
confirmations
389689
spent
true